what is the trend in ionisation energies across a period?
there will be a general increase across a period, as the no. of protons in the nucleus increases so there is higher attraction on electrons
why does the first ionisation energy decrease between group 2 and 3?
in group 3 the outmost electrons are in p orbitals whereas in group 2 they are is s orbitals, so electrons can be removed easier
why does the first ionisation energy decrease between group 5 and 6?
group 5 electrons in the p orbital are single electrons however, in group 6 the outer electrons are paired with some repulsion and, therefore easier to remove.
does the first ionisation decrease or increase down a group? why?
decreases; shielding will increase as well as the atomic radius and therefore will have a further distance between outer electrons and nucleus leading to weaker attraction.
